Cost of Water Runoff Control in Greenwood

Water runoff control is a crucial aspect of urban planning in Greenwood, IN. Effective management of stormwater helps prevent flooding, reduces pollution, and protects local waterways. Understanding the costs associated with water runoff control can help homeowners, businesses, and municipalities make informed decisions.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Type of Control System: The specific method used, such as retention ponds, permeable pavements, or green roofs, can significantly impact costs.
  • Project Size: Larger projects generally require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
  • Local Regulations: Compliance with Greenwood's local codes and regulations may add to the overall expense.
  • Labor Costs: The cost of hiring skilled labor in Greenwood can vary, affecting the total project cost.
  • Material Quality: Higher-quality materials may increase upfront costs but often offer better long-term performance.
  • Site Conditions: The existing condition of the site, including soil type and topography, can influence the complexity and cost of the project.
  • Maintenance Requirements: Ongoing maintenance needs can add to the long-term costs of water runoff control systems.

Average Costs for

Task Average Cost (Greenwood, IN)
Installation of Retention Pond $10,000 - $50,000
Permeable Pavement $8 - $15 per square foot
Green Roof Installation $15 - $25 per square foot
Rain Garden Installation $3,000 - $7,000
Stormwater Drainage System $5,000 - $20,000
Regular Maintenance $500 - $2,000 annually

Understanding these factors and average costs can help you plan and budget for effective water runoff control in Greenwood, IN.
